scientists trying to determine evolutionary relationships among organisms sometimes search for clues by examining how each organism develops from a fertilized egg cell. what name is given to the scientific study of how organisms develop from a single cell into independent living creatures?

The answer is Embroyology. Scientists trying to determine evolutionary relationships among organisms sometimes search for clues by examining how each organism develops from a fertilized egg cell. The name given to the scientific study of how organisms develop from a single cell into independent living creatures is Embryology. This is the study of living creatures starting from fertilization up to the development of an embryo. It is the study of the formation and development of an embryo and fetus.
